Ethan Rohrer wrote:

> I am trying to port some code from my UNIX account to my DOS machine.
> My program reads a binary file using a open()/read()/close() sequence.
> It worked like a champ in my UNIX account.
> 
> Now, under DJGPP, I find that read() stops reading when it encounters
> the EOF character (0x1A), which just happens to occur every here and
> there in my binary files...

Easy.  Open the file in binary mode.
